SENATE POLICY COMMITTEES

For salaries and expenses of the Majority Policy Committee and the Minority Policy Committee, $133,975 for each such committee; in all, $267,950. JOINT ECONOMIC COMMITTEE

For salaries and expenses of the Joint Economic Committee, $247,555, and in addition $12,000 to be derived by transfer from the appropriation for fiscal year 1961. JOINT COMMITTEE ON ATOMIC ENERGY

For salaries and expenses of the Joint Committee on Atomic Energy, $294,010. JOINT COMMITTEE ON PRINTING

For salaries and expenses of the Joint Committee on Printing, $114,125; for expenses of compiling, preparing, and indexing the Congressional Directory, $1,600; in all, $115,725. VICE P R E S I D E N T ' S

AUTOMOBILE

For purchase, exchange, driving, maintenance, and operation of an automobile for the Vice President, $8,710. AUTOMOBILE FOR THE PRESIDENT PRO TEMPORE

For purchase, exchange, driving, maintenance, and operation of an automobile for the President pro tempore of the Senate, $8,960. AUTOMOBILES FOR MAJORITY AND MINORITY LEADERS

For purchase, exchange, driving, maintenance, and operation of two automobiles, one for the Majority Leader of the Senate, and one for the Minority Leader of the Senate, $17,420. FURNITURE

For services and materials in cleaning and repairing furniture, and for the purchase of furniture, $31,190: Provided, That the furniture purchased is not available from other agencies of the Government. INQUIRIES AND INVESTIGATIONS

For expenses of inquiries and investigations ordered by the Senate or conducted pursuant to section 134(a) of Public Law 601, Seventy-ninth Congress, including $380,000 for the Committee on Appropriations, to be available also for the purposes mentioned in Senate Resolution Numbered 193, agreed to October 14, 1943, $3,797,210. FOLDING DOCUMENTS

For the employment of personnel for folding speeches and pamphlets at a gross rate of not exceeding $1.90 per hour per person, $34,295.
